Soccer Recap: Noblesville vs. Harrison

Noblesville had already proven themselves in the regular season and they didn't miss a beat now that it's playoff time. They put the hurt on the Harrison Raiders with a sharp 5-0 win on Wednesday. The result was nothing new for the Millers, who have now won 11 matches by three goals or more so far this season.

They hit Harrison with a four-pronged attack, as the team got scores from Corynn Fleck (2), Sophie Hedges, Brooklyn Gibbons, and Meredith Tippner.

Noblesville's victory was their fourth straight at home, which pushed their record up to 16-0-2. As for Harrison, the defeat snapped their winning streak at four games and leaves them with a 13-7 record.

Noblesville will square off against Homestead at 2:00 p.m. on Saturday. Homestead will roll in looking for their 15th straight win, something Noblesville surely won't give up without a fight. Harrison does not have any more games scheduled as of now.
